Responsibilities

  • Support the Clinical Operations teams in the completion of all required tasks to meet trial, departmental and project goals.
  • Maintain, share and champion a thorough knowledge ICH GCP, appropriate regulations, relevant SOPs and internal tracking systems.
  • Collaborate with Clinical Trials Manager (CTM) and Clinical Research Associates (CRAs) to resolve clinical trial documentation issues.
  • Establish, organize and maintain clinical study documentation (e.g. Trial Master File, study level and site level documents, etc.) including preparation for internal/external audits, final reconciliation and archival.
  • Review clinical trial documents to determine compliance with Good Documentation Practices (GDocP), file and track study documents.
  • Determine materials and other resources needed to conduct the clinical trial and manage their acquisition and distribution.
  • Audit Investigator/Site invoices for accuracy, and reconcile invoices against the case report forms (CRFs) and budget for payment submission.
  • Gather central IRB report information, submit the report to the central IRB portal and track the IRB submissions from beginning through approval.
  • Facilitate the collection and review of required study documents during site start-up
  • Contact clinical sites for specific requests (e.g., enrollment updates, missing documentation, meeting arrangements, etc.)
  • Route study documents to the appropriate personnel for validated digital signatures
  • Submit purchase requisitions to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) System for Clinical Operations functional groups as needed.
  • Request invoice approval from internal supplier designee.
  • Participate in clinical operations safety reporting activities; distribute, file and track safety reports and IRB submissions.
  • Facilitate clinical operations team meeting coordination, agenda preparation and meeting minutes preparation
  • Performs ad-hoc and cross-functional duties and/or projects as assigned to support business needs and provide developmental opportunities.
